    As one who is also a fan of eco!Jacen, I too was disillusioned by the path the EU took his character in LotF.

    It was perfect how you had his brother Anakin as his ghost for the past, Yoda for the present (haha, awesome!), and Vader for the future--which is especially true to the tone of Dickens' original since the ghost of Christmas future is the most ruthless of the three.

    That might be the best line in this fic. :D That, and Skywalker's line that Mara was not Jacen's sacrifice, but the true sacrifice was his soul. Profound.

    There is only one thing that I think would improve this already awesome story, but it involves having read ahead to the FotJ series. In that one (particularly in Abyss), this is revealed about Jacen:

    During his 5-year journey before DNT, he saw a vision of a Dark Man on a black throne surrounded by dark side warriors who would plunge the galaxy into everlasting darkness. Since then he became obsessed with altering this vision, and so at the end of Invincible, that vision of the Dark Man changes into one of Allana as a queen of light sitting on a White Throne during a time of unprecedented galactic peace. In the FotJ series, both Leia and Luke have this same vision of Allana. So it could be argued that Caedus/Jacen's obsession with overprotecting Allana in DN and LotF is not only parental concern (though it definitely is that) but also his way of trying to the save the galaxy, in his particularly warped way.
